Academy Award-Nominee Shohreh Aghadashloo (House of Sand and Fog, "24") narrates this award-winning documentary that chronicles filmmaker Aryana Farshad's soul-stirring spiritual odyssey deep into the heart of her native Iran after a twenty-five year absence. At the risk of confiscation of film equipment and the threat of drug traffickers, Farshad embarked on a courageous and unprecedented cinematic tour to capture on film rites and rituals hidden for centuries. From the women's chamber of the Great Mosque, to the temple-caves in the land of Zarathustra, to the sacred dance of the Dervishes in Kurdistan, she gained access to religious ceremonies and locations never before seen by the outside world.
